In a horizontal attitude the probe cannot make comparative probing
measurements from opposite orientations. The measuring touch probe can be
used only for digitizing in the horizontal attitude. It is not possible to align the
workpiece in a horizontal attitude.
Warning
Be sure to enter the correct value in MP6322 for the attitude of the touch
probe. Otherwise the calculation of the maximum deflection from MP6330
may by incorrect.
Danger of breakage!
If the stylus is deflected by a distance larger than that defined in MP6330, the
blinking error message Stylus deflection exceeds max.: appears.

In MP6310, select the mean deflection depth during digitizing.
• For standard parts: Input value = 1 mm
• On parts with steep sides that are scanned at high speed:
Input value > 1 mm
With the deflection depth, the probing force of the touch probe can be
optimized.
After starting the "meander" or "contour lines" cycle, the probe moves at the
feed rate defined in MP6361 to the clearance height, and then in the working
plane to the point above the starting point. It then moves at the reduced feed
rate defined in MP6350 to the MIN point or to the first touch point:
7 7 7 7
In MP6361, enter a feed rate for rapid traverse in the probing cycle.
7 7 7 7
In MP6350, enter a feed rate for positioning to the MIN point and probing
the contour.
7 7 7 7
With MP6362, select whether the scanning feed rate is automatically
reduced if the ball tip deviates from the path.
During scanning of contour lines, the probe sometimes ends the contour line
at a point located near but not exactly at the starting point:
7 7 7 7
In MP6390, define a target window within which the probe is considered to
have returned to the starting point. The target window is a square.
Input value: Half the edge length of the square
MP6360 (probing feed rate) and MP6361 (rapid traverse in the probing cycle)
are effective in the standard probe cycles.
MP6200
Selection of triggering or measuring touch probe (only with
"digitizing with measuring touch probe" option)
Input:
0: Triggering touch probe (e.g. TS 220)
1: Measuring touch probe
MP6310
Deflection depth of the stylus (measuring touch probe)
Input:
0.1000 to 2.0000 [mm]
MP6320
Counting direction of encoder output signals (measuring
touch probe)
Format:
%xxx
Input:
Bits 0 to 2 represent axes X to Z
0: Positive
1: Negative
